Australia -- Victoria Weather Update

MELBOURNE - Jun 11/12 - SNS -- The current forecast for the state of Victoria was released by Australia's Bureau of Meteorology.

Weather Situation
A large high pressure system centred just to the southeast of Tasmania will drift over the south Tasman Sea on Tuesday and Wednesday. A weakening cold front will approach southwestern Victoria from the west on Tuesday night then slip away to the south. A low pressure system is expected to form south of the Bight during Wednesday and will be slow moving. The low will remain well to the west of Tasmania on Thursday and Friday.
Forecast for the rest of MondayFog and mist patches redeveloping tonight mainly over central and eastern districts. Isolated showers over far east Gippsland. Light winds.Tuesday 12 JuneA cold morning with areas of frost. Morning fog patches mainly in the east then fine for most of the day with high cloud increasing over the west. The chance of light showers in the far southwest during the evening. A cool day with generally light to moderate northeast to northerly wind.Wednesday 13 JuneIsolated showers in the southwest. Local early frost and fog in the east. A cool and partly cloudy day with moderate to fresh northerly wind.Thursday 14 JuneIsolated showers affecting most districts. A cool to mild and partly cloudy day with fresh north to northwesterly winds.Friday 15 JuneIsolated showers mostly over the southwest and about the eastern ranges. A cool to mild day with moderate to fresh northwesterly winds.The next routine forecast will be issued at 5:00 am EST Tuesday.Product IDV10310
